[3] The company achieved success with MagicBricks, an online real estate platform launched in 2006 and iDiva, a women's lifestyle portal in 2009.

[4][5] Times Internet made a series of acquisitions—buying majority stakes in MensXP in 2012,[6] Cricbuzz, Coupondunia and Dineout in 2014,[7][8][9] Taskbucks in 2015,[10] 'The Viral Shots' and WillowTV in 2016.

[22] On 24 April 2019, Times Internet participated as a lead investor in $35.5 million (Rs 2.50 billion) Series-A funding round of Mobile Premier League (MPL).

[26] In 2023, after failing to find a buyer, the music streaming service Gaana was consolidated with another Times Group company Entertainment Network India Limited (ENIL) for a consideration of ₹25 lakh.

[27] In 2024, Times Internet sold MX Player to Amazon for around $100 million[28] and ET Money to 360 One WAM for ₹366 crore in stock swap and cash.
